Carfentanil is a synthetic opioid that is 10,000 times more potent than morphine and 100 times more … WebFeb 23, 2024 · Possession of Fentanyl (2024 Update) Posted on Feb. 23, 2024, 10:43 am by Phil Dixon. In an earlier post, I wrote that simple possession of fentanyl was a misdemeanor Schedule II offense under then-current law. No more. Effective Dec. 1, 2024, fentanyl possession in any amount is treated as a felony. WebFentanyl. Note: In some countries, this medicine may only be approved for veterinary use. In the US, Fentanyl (fentanyl systemic) is a member of the drug class Opioids (narcotic analgesics) and is used to treat Anesthesia, Anesthetic Adjunct, Breakthrough Pain, Chronic Pain, Dercum's Disease, Pain, Postoperative Pain and Sedation.
